当前位置:首页 > 编程语言 > 正文内容

html版本,探索HTML版本的网页设计与开发奥秘

wzgly3个月前 (06-03)编程语言5
当然可以,请提供您希望我生成摘要的内容。

了解HTML版本:用户视角下的实用指南

用户解答: 大家好,我是一名前端开发新手,最近在学习HTML的时候,发现HTML有多个版本,比如HTML4和HTML5,我想了解一下,这些版本之间有什么区别,我应该学习哪个版本呢?希望有大神能帮我解答一下。

我将从以下几个方面地为大家讲解HTML版本的相关知识。

html版本

一:HTML版本的介绍

  1. HTML版本的历史:HTML(HyperText Markup Language)是一种用于创建网页的标准标记语言,自从1990年HTML诞生以来,它已经经历了多个版本,HTML1、HTML2、HTML3等版本逐渐演变为现在的HTML4和HTML5。

  2. HTML4的特点:HTML4是HTML的第四个版本,它于1997年发布,HTML4引入了许多新的元素和属性,如表格、框架、层等,使得网页设计更加丰富。

  3. HTML5的革新:HTML5是HTML的第五个版本,它于2014年正式发布,HTML5在HTML4的基础上进行了大量改进,包括对移动设备的优化、新元素、新API等。

二:HTML4与HTML5的主要区别

  1. 语义化标签:HTML5引入了许多新的语义化标签,如<header>, <footer>, <article>, <section>等,这些标签有助于提高网页的可读性和搜索引擎优化(SEO)。

  2. 多媒体支持:HTML5对多媒体的支持更加完善,如<video><audio>标签可以直接在网页中嵌入视频和音频,无需额外的插件。

    html版本
  3. 离线应用:HTML5支持离线应用,用户可以在没有网络连接的情况下访问网页应用。

三:学习哪个版本更合适

  1. HTML4的适用性:如果你正在维护一些老旧的网页,或者需要兼容某些特定的浏览器,学习HTML4可能更有必要。

  2. HTML5的广泛性:由于HTML5的广泛支持和现代特性,学习HTML5将有助于你更好地适应前端开发的需求。

  3. 未来趋势:随着Web技术的发展,HTML5已经成为主流,因此学习HTML5将更有利于你的职业发展。

四:HTML5的新特性

  1. Canvas:Canvas是一个可以在网页上绘制图形的API,它允许开发者创建动态、交互式的图形。

    html版本
  2. Geolocation:Geolocation API允许网页访问用户的地理位置信息,从而实现基于位置的网页应用。

  3. Web Storage:Web Storage API允许网页存储数据,即使在没有网络连接的情况下也能访问。

五:HTML版本的选择与迁移

  1. 版本选择:选择HTML版本时,应考虑项目的需求、目标用户群体以及个人技能。

  2. 迁移策略:如果你需要将HTML4网页迁移到HTML5,可以逐步替换旧的元素和属性,并利用HTML5的新特性来增强网页功能。

HTML版本的选择和了解对于前端开发者来说至关重要,通过学习HTML的不同版本,你可以更好地掌握前端开发的技能,并为未来的项目做好准备,希望这篇文章能帮助你更好地理解HTML版本,并在实际工作中发挥出更大的作用。

其他相关扩展阅读资料参考文献:

HTML版本的发展与演变

HTML版本的介绍

随着互联网技术的飞速发展,HTML(HyperText Markup Language)作为网页开发的基础语言,其版本也在不断迭代更新,从最初的HTML1.0到现在的HTML5,每一个版本都带来了全新的特性和改进,使得网页开发更加便捷、高效。

主要HTML版本及其特点

HTML 1.0(过渡版本)

  • 发布时间:早期互联网时期。
  • 特点:提供了基本的网页元素和结构,如标题、段落和链接等,但由于功能有限,很少单独使用。

HTML 4.0(功能丰富化)

  • 发布时间:上世纪90年代末。
  • 特点:引入了更多标签和属性,支持图像、音频和视频等多媒体内容,同时支持更复杂的数据表格和表单元素。
  • 重要改进点:增强了网页交互性和视觉表现能力。

HTML 5(跨平台与多媒体支持)

  • 发布时间:本世纪初。
  • 特点:提供了更丰富的多媒体支持,包括视频和音频的内置播放功能,同时支持离线应用、本地存储等高级功能。
  • 创新点:引入Canvas和SVG绘图技术,增强了网页的动态效果和交互性,支持语义化标签,提高了文档内容的可读性。

HTML版本的进步对网页开发的影响

用户体验的改善 随着HTML版本的升级,网页的交互性和动态效果得到了极大的提升,使得用户可以享受到更加丰富的浏览体验。

开发效率的提高 新版本的HTML提供了更多的标签和属性,使得开发者可以更加便捷地创建复杂的网页结构和布局,新的API和工具的出现也大大提高了开发效率。

跨平台支持的增强 随着移动设备的普及,HTML5的跨平台特性使得网页在各种设备上都能得到良好的展示和体验,推动了响应式设计和移动优先策略的发展。

最新动态与未来趋势

HTML5的普及与完善 尽管HTML5已经发布多年,但在实际生产和应用中,许多网站还在逐步迁移到这一版本,其完善和普及工作仍在持续进行。

新技术的融合与创新 随着Web技术的不断发展,新的技术如WebAssembly、WebVR等正在与HTML结合,为网页开发带来更多的可能性,这些新技术将推动HTML向更高的版本发展。

学习与实践的重要性 对于开发者而言,紧跟HTML版本的更新和发展趋势是非常重要的,通过不断学习和实践,可以掌握最新的技术和工具,提高开发效率,创造出更加优秀的作品,对于个人职业生涯的发展也有着积极的推动作用,建议开发者保持对新技术的关注和学习,不断积累实践经验,随着技术的不断进步和互联网的持续发展,HTML版本的不断更新和改进是一个必然趋势。随着HTML版本的持续演进和发展,网页开发的技术和工具也在不断进步和完善,从最初的简单文本链接到现在丰富的多媒体内容和动态交互效果,HTML的发展为互联网的发展提供了强大的支持,未来随着新技术的融合和创新,HTML将继续向着更高的版本和目标发展前进,对于开发者而言紧跟时代步伐不断学习和实践是非常重要的,同时我们也要看到随着移动互联网的普及和发展响应式设计和移动优先策略将成为未来的重要趋势之一这也需要我们不断地探索和实践以适应不断变化的市场需求和技术环境。

扫描二维码推送至手机访问。

版权声明:本文由码界编程网发布,如需转载请注明出处。

本文链接:http://b2b.dropc.cn/bcyy/1725.html

分享给朋友:

“html版本,探索HTML版本的网页设计与开发奥秘” 的相关文章

北京c语言培训班,北京C语言编程实战培训班

北京c语言培训班,北京C语言编程实战培训班

北京C语言培训班专注于教授C语言编程基础,课程涵盖从入门到进阶,包括数据结构、算法等核心内容,通过系统学习,学员将掌握C语言编程技能,为后续学习其他编程语言打下坚实基础,培训班采用小班授课,注重理论与实践相结合,帮助学员快速提升编程能力。 大家好,我是李明,最近在找培训班学习C语言,因为我对编程很...

html网页设计作品欣赏,网页设计之美,HTML佳作赏析

html网页设计作品欣赏,网页设计之美,HTML佳作赏析

在HTML网页设计作品欣赏中,我们看到了一系列精美的网页设计案例,这些作品展示了丰富的创意和精湛的技术,包括独特的布局、优雅的色彩搭配、创新的交互效果和优化的用户体验,从个人博客到企业官网,从电商平台到创意展示页,这些设计作品不仅美观大方,而且在功能性和实用性上也表现出色,为网页设计领域提供了灵感和...

java环境变量设置win7,设置Win7系统Java环境变量教程

java环境变量设置win7,设置Win7系统Java环境变量教程

在Windows 7系统中设置Java环境变量,首先需要在控制面板中找到“系统”并点击进入,在系统窗口中,选择“高级系统设置”,然后在系统属性对话框中点击“环境变量”按钮,在环境变量窗口中,找到并编辑“Path”变量,添加Java的bin目录路径,新建一个名为“JAVA_HOME”的环境变量,将其值...

animate中国哪里有分店,Animate中国分店分布指南

animate中国哪里有分店,Animate中国分店分布指南

Animate中国分店遍布全国,具体分布如下:北京、上海、广州、深圳、成都、杭州、南京、武汉、重庆、西安、沈阳、天津、济南、青岛、郑州、福州、厦门、苏州、无锡、宁波、东莞、珠海、昆明、南宁、长沙、合肥、南昌、太原、石家庄、长春、哈尔滨、呼和浩特、乌鲁木齐等城市均有分店,如需查询具体分店地址,请访问A...

c语言指针类型,C语言指针类型解析

c语言指针类型,C语言指针类型解析

C语言中的指针类型是用于存储变量地址的数据类型,指针变量可以指向内存中的任何位置,通过解引用操作符(*)访问其指向的值,指针在动态内存分配、数组操作、函数参数传递等方面有广泛应用,使用指针时需注意内存地址的合法性,避免造成内存访问错误。 嗨,大家好!今天我想和大家聊聊C语言中的一个非常重要的概念—...

如何查看php文件,轻松掌握,查看PHP文件全攻略

如何查看php文件,轻松掌握,查看PHP文件全攻略

要查看PHP文件,您可以通过以下步骤进行:,1. 打开文件管理器或终端。,2. 定位到PHP文件所在的目录。,3. 使用文本编辑器(如Notepad++、Sublime Text或VS Code)打开文件。,4. 如果使用命令行,可以使用cat、less、more或nano等命令查看文件内容。,5....